Malpractice lawyers are lawyers who focus their practice on lawsuits involving professional liability. These cases are often complex and require the assistance of medical experts. These cases can also be expensive. This has led many malpractice attorneys declining to take these cases.

Medical malpractice occurs when a doctor is not following accepted medical procedures, causing injury or death to the patient. Compensation can include economic damages like lost income and medical expenses and non-economic losses such as pain and suffering.

Every time you visit a doctor you expect them to follow certain standards of care. If they don't adhere to these standards and this failure causes injuries or health complications, then you could bring a lawsuit for medical malpractice. A malpractice lawyer can help you navigate the process of filing a lawsuit, and make sure that your case is a viable one. They will gather the most evidence they can, and possess a thorough understanding of New York Law.
